How they compare

Togo currently reports 12.76 million against 12.43 million in Georgia, a difference of 330,400.

The two have swapped places 9 times across 175 shared years of data; in 1850 it was Georgia ahead.

Georgia ranks 140th and Togo ranks 139th of 199 countries.

Across the 18 decades both report, Georgia averaged higher in 12 and Togo in 6.
